While this book started off really slow for me (and I almost DNF’d), as soon as I got all the context-setting stuff out of the way, it was really interesting. The concept of a “western” that is also post-apocalyptic is just a really cool idea to begin with, and I think it was executed fairly well. There’s a good mix of character-driven and plot-driven narrative, and it kept me reading until the end. It was enjoyable and out-of-the-box.
